Effectivness Of Shwadrashta Tail Matra Basti In Management Of Katigraha (Lumbar Spondylosis).

Phase 2
Conditions
Health Condition 1: M471- Other spondylosis with myelopathy

Inclusion Criteria

1)Indication of matra basti.

2)Patient fulfilling the selection criteria and between the age of 45 to 60 years.

3)Patient having classical sign and symptoms of katigraha such as pain (shool) and stiffness (stambha).

4)Degenerative changes evident on x Ray LS spine.

Exclusion Criteria

1)Fracture of lumber spine

2)Patient who not fit for basti (bleeding piles,rectal prolapse)

3)Children and pregnant women, lactating mothers and during menstrual cycle.

4)Patient with other joint deformity or disease such as TB of spine,spinal abnormality, congenital scoliosis

5)Patient with rheumatoid arthritis will be excluded from study.

6)Patient with immuno compromised disease, psychiatric disease.

7)Patient taking oral pain killers,NSAIDS or ayurvedic drug for pain and patient undergoing any local karma like lepa,upnaha, agnikarma etc.
